Les trois composants de la base de données

Quels sont les trois composants de la base de données ?
Composants d’une base de données

  • un fichier de contrôle qui spécifie le nom et l’emplacement des fichiers, le nom de la base,…
  • plusieurs fichiers de données pour stocker les données.
  • au moins deux fichiers de reprise après panne qui contiennent les modifications récentes.
En savoir plus sur perso.liris.cnrs.fr


Une base de données est un ensemble organisé de données stockées électroniquement. Elle permet de stocker des informations et de les manipuler facilement. Les trois principaux composants de la base de données sont le système de gestion de base de données (SGBD), le schéma de la base de données et les données.

Le SGBD est le cerveau de la base de données. Il est responsable de la création, de la gestion, du stockage et de la récupération des données. Il est également responsable de l’interaction avec les utilisateurs et les applications qui utilisent la base de données. Parmi les SGBD les plus populaires, on peut citer Oracle, MySQL, SQL Server et PostgreSQL.


Le schéma de la base de données décrit la structure de la base de données. Il définit les tables, les colonnes, les clés primaires et étrangères ainsi que les relations entre les tables. Le schéma est créé lors de la conception de la base de données et est modifié si nécessaire au fil du temps.

Les données sont l’essence de la base de données. Elles sont stockées dans des tables et sont organisées de manière à permettre une recherche et une mise à jour faciles. Les données peuvent être de différents types, tels que des nombres, des dates, des chaînes de caractères, des images, des sons, etc.

Comment et dans quel but Utilise-t-on une base de données ?

Une base de données est utilisée pour stocker des informations et les manipuler facilement. Elle permet de stocker des données de manière structurée et de les interroger à l’aide de requêtes. Les bases de données sont utilisées dans de nombreux domaines, tels que la finance, les soins de santé, les médias sociaux, la vente au détail, etc.

Les avantages d’une base de données

Les avantages d’une base de données sont nombreux. Elle permet de stocker des données de manière organisée et structurée, ce qui permet une recherche et une mise à jour faciles. Elle permet également de récupérer rapidement des informations en fonction de certains critères. Les bases de données peuvent être utilisées pour stocker de grandes quantités de données et peuvent être utilisées pour exécuter des tâches complexes.

Les différents modèles NoSQL

Le modèle NoSQL est un modèle de base de données qui diffère du modèle relationnel traditionnel. Les modèles NoSQL sont conçus pour gérer de grandes quantités de données non structurées. Les principaux modèles NoSQL sont le modèle de document, le modèle de colonne, le modèle de graphe et le modèle clé-valeur.

Les deux principaux types de bases de données que tu pourras rencontrer

Les deux principaux types de bases de données sont les bases de données relationnelles et les bases de données non relationnelles. Les bases de données relationnelles sont basées sur le modèle relationnel et stockent les données dans des tables. Les bases de données non relationnelles sont utilisées pour stocker des données non structurées et sont basées sur des modèles tels que le modèle de document, le modèle de colonne, le modèle de graphe et le modèle clé-valeur.

Les meilleures bases de données à l’heure actuelle

Les meilleures bases de données à l’heure actuelle sont Oracle, MySQL, SQL Server et PostgreSQL pour les bases de données relationnelles. Pour les bases de données non relationnelles, les meilleures bases de données sont MongoDB, Apache Cassandra et Neo4j. Le choix de la base de données dépend des besoins spécifiques de l’entreprise ou de l’organisation.

FAQ
Quel est la nature des différents types de données ?

Les différents types de données peuvent être classés en trois catégories principales : les données numériques, les données textuelles et les données temporelles. Les données numériques sont des nombres qui peuvent être utilisés pour effectuer des calculs mathématiques. Les données textuelles sont des mots ou des phrases qui décrivent des informations. Les données temporelles sont des informations sur les dates et les heures.

Quelle différence entre information et donnée ?

En termes généraux, la différence entre l’information et les données est que les données sont des faits bruts et non traités, tandis que l’information est une donnée qui a été organisée, structurée et présentée de manière significative pour être utile aux utilisateurs. Les données sont souvent considérées comme une matière première pour produire de l’information.

Quelles sont les caractéristiques d’une table ?

Les caractéristiques d’une table dans une base de données incluent des colonnes qui définissent les types de données stockées, des lignes qui représentent des enregistrements individuels et une clé primaire unique pour identifier chaque enregistrement de manière unique. De plus, une table peut avoir des contraintes pour garantir l’intégrité des données, telles que des contraintes d’intégrité référentielle pour maintenir la cohérence entre les tables liées.


Laisser un commentaire